SAP SDB_VOLLOG_TREE structure fields - Full list of fields found in SAP data dictionary
Field | Description | Data Element | Data Type | length (Dec) | Check table | Conversion Routine | Domain Name | MemoryID | SHLP |
NODE_KEY | Tree Control: Node Key | TV_NODEKEY | CHAR | 12 | TM_CHAR12 | ||||
PARENT_KEY | Tree Control: Node Key | TV_NODEKEY | CHAR | 12 | TM_CHAR12 | ||||
NODE_TEXT | ALV Control: Cell Content | LVC_VALUE | CHAR | 128 | TEXT128 | ||||
EXPANDED | Replacement for Real Boolean Type: 'X' == True '' == False | WDY_BOOLEAN | CHAR | 1 | WDY_BOOLEAN | ||||
ISLEAF | Replacement for Real Boolean Type: 'X' == True '' == False | WDY_BOOLEAN | CHAR | 1 | WDY_BOOLEAN | ||||
VISIBLE | Web Dynpro: Visibility | WDUI_VISIBILITY | NUMC | 2 | WDUI_VISIBILITY | ||||
WDB_CELLDESIGN | Web Dynpro: TableCellDesign | WDUI_TABLE_CELL_DESIGN | NUMC | 2 | WDUI_TABLE_CELL_DESIGN | ||||
WDB_SEMANTIC_COLOR | Web Dynpro: TextViewSemanticColor | WDUI_TEXTVIEW_SEM_COL | NUMC | 2 | WDUI_TEXTVIEW_SEM_COL | ||||
GUI_N_IMAGE | Tree Control: Icon / Image | TV_IMAGE | CHAR | 46 | TV_IMAGE | ||||
GUI_EXP_IMAGE | Tree Control: Icon / Image | TV_IMAGE | CHAR | 46 | TV_IMAGE | ||||
GUI_REAL_NODE_KEY | ALV Tree Control: Node Key | LVC_NKEY | CHAR | 12 | |||||
GUI_REAL_PARENT_KEY | ALV Tree Control: Node Key | LVC_NKEY | CHAR | 12 | |||||
GUI_STYLE | Natural Number | INT4 | INT4 | 10 | INT4 | ||||
GUI_ITEM_LAYOUT | 0 | ||||||||
ID | Natural Number | INT4 | INT4 | 10 | INT4 | ||||
VOLTYPE | 'DATA', 'LOG', 'SYS' | 0 | |||||||
INT_NAME | For Example: DATA0002, LOG003, SYS001 | 0 | |||||||
SIZE_KB | SYSDBA.MONITOR.VALUE | ADA_VALUE | DEC | 20 | DEC20 | ||||
IS_MIRROR | General Flag | FLAG | CHAR | 1 | FLAG | ||||
DELETEABLE | General Flag | FLAG | CHAR | 1 | FLAG | ||||
DEV_TYPE | Character Field Length = 10 | CHAR10 | CHAR | 10 | CHAR10 | ||||
DEVICE | Character field, length 64 | CHAR64 | CHAR | 64 | CHAR64 | ||||
READCNT | SYSDBA.MONITOR.VALUE | ADA_VALUE | DEC | 20 | DEC20 | ||||
READPGCNT | SYSDBA.MONITOR.VALUE | ADA_VALUE | DEC | 20 | DEC20 | ||||
WRITECNT | SYSDBA.MONITOR.VALUE | ADA_VALUE | DEC | 20 | DEC20 | ||||
WRITEPGCNT | SYSDBA.MONITOR.VALUE | ADA_VALUE | DEC | 20 | DEC20 | ||||
DISPLAY_SIZE | 0 | ||||||||
DISPLAY_SCALE | Version Number Component | CHAR2 | CHAR | 2 | CHAR2 | ||||
LOG_PARTITION | Natural Number | INT4 | INT4 | 10 | INT4 |
